ST. LOUIS (KMOX) - It could have been the perfect crime except for one thing — the robber left his keys behind.
25-year-old Donovan Whitt is now officially charged with 1st-degree robbery and armed criminal action in connection with the New Year’s Eve day hold-up at a gas station on Bates at Virginia.
He and another man reportedly burst in, pointed a gun at an attendant and demanded cash and checks.
But the keys left behind at the scene led inspectors right to Whitt’s home in the 6300 block of Minnesota.
